public static enum Capabilities.Capability extends java.lang.Enum<Capabilities.Capability>
| Enum Constant and Description | 
|---|
| BINARY_ATTRIBUTEScan handle binary attributes | 
| BINARY_CLASScan handle binary classes | 
| DATE_ATTRIBUTEScan handle date attributes | 
| DATE_CLASScan handle date classes | 
| EMPTY_NOMINAL_ATTRIBUTEScan handle empty nominal attributes | 
| EMPTY_NOMINAL_CLASScan handle empty nominal classes | 
| MISSING_CLASS_VALUEScan handle missing values in class attribute | 
| MISSING_VALUEScan handle missing values in attributes | 
| NO_CLASScan handle data without class attribute, eg clusterers | 
| NOMINAL_ATTRIBUTEScan handle nominal attributes | 
| NOMINAL_CLASScan handle nominal classes | 
| NUMERIC_ATTRIBUTEScan handle numeric attributes | 
| NUMERIC_CLASScan handle numeric classes | 
| ONLY_MULTIINSTANCEcan handle multi-instance data | 
| RELATIONAL_ATTRIBUTEScan handle relational attributes | 
| RELATIONAL_CLASScan handle relational classes | 
| STRING_ATTRIBUTEScan handle string attributes | 
| STRING_CLASScan handle string classes | 
| UNARY_ATTRIBUTEScan handle unary attributes | 
| UNARY_CLASScan handle unary classes | 
| Modifier and Type | Method and Description | 
|---|---|
| boolean | isAttribute()returns true if the capability is an attribute | 
| boolean | isAttributeCapability()returns true if the capability is an attribute capability | 
| boolean | isClass()returns true if the capability is a class | 
| boolean | isClassCapability()returns true if the capability is a other capability | 
| boolean | isOtherCapability()returns true if the capability is a class capability | 
| java.lang.String | toString()returns the display string of the capability | 
| static Capabilities.Capability | valueOf(java.lang.String name)Returns the enum constant of this type with the specified name. | 
| static Capabilities.Capability[] | values()Returns an array containing the constants of this enum type, in
the order they are declared. | 
public static final Capabilities.Capability NOMINAL_ATTRIBUTES
public static final Capabilities.Capability BINARY_ATTRIBUTES
public static final Capabilities.Capability UNARY_ATTRIBUTES
public static final Capabilities.Capability EMPTY_NOMINAL_ATTRIBUTES
public static final Capabilities.Capability NUMERIC_ATTRIBUTES
public static final Capabilities.Capability DATE_ATTRIBUTES
public static final Capabilities.Capability STRING_ATTRIBUTES
public static final Capabilities.Capability RELATIONAL_ATTRIBUTES
public static final Capabilities.Capability MISSING_VALUES
public static final Capabilities.Capability NO_CLASS
public static final Capabilities.Capability NOMINAL_CLASS
public static final Capabilities.Capability BINARY_CLASS
public static final Capabilities.Capability UNARY_CLASS
public static final Capabilities.Capability EMPTY_NOMINAL_CLASS
public static final Capabilities.Capability NUMERIC_CLASS
public static final Capabilities.Capability DATE_CLASS
public static final Capabilities.Capability STRING_CLASS
public static final Capabilities.Capability RELATIONAL_CLASS
public static final Capabilities.Capability MISSING_CLASS_VALUES
public static final Capabilities.Capability ONLY_MULTIINSTANCE
public static Capabilities.Capability[] values()
for (Capabilities.Capability c : Capabilities.Capability.values()) System.out.println(c);
public static Capabilities.Capability valueOf(java.lang.String name)
name - the name of the enum constant to be returned.java.lang.IllegalArgumentException - if this enum type has no constant with the specified namejava.lang.NullPointerException - if the argument is nullpublic boolean isAttribute()
public boolean isClass()
public boolean isAttributeCapability()
public boolean isOtherCapability()
public boolean isClassCapability()
public java.lang.String toString()
toString in class java.lang.Enum<Capabilities.Capability>